I was introduced to Professor Layton the same way I was introduced to Pokémon: through my babysitter. I remember being bored at her house, so she gave me a bunch of videogames to try out. I played a completed save file of, which kickstarted my fascination with the franchise. But the series she introduced me to that I most fell in love with was Professor Layton.
As I got older, I began to play the games more as they were intended, engaging with the puzzles instead of immediately seeking the answers from other sources. I came to deeply enjoy them as well, as at least the story-critical ones always felt fair and novel.
